Understanding GLP-1 Clinics in Germany: A Comprehensive Guide to Modern Weight Management
Over the last few years, the landscape of metabolic health and weight management has actually gone through a substantial transformation. At the center of this shift is a class of medications understood as Glucagon-like peptide-1 (GLP-1) receptor agonists. In Germany, the rise of specialized GLP-1 centers-- frequently integrated into obesity centers (Adipositaszentren) or metabolic health practices-- has supplied clients with a structured, clinically supervised course toward dealing with obesity and Type 2 diabetes.
This article checks out the operational structure of GLP-1 clinics in Germany, the regulative environment surrounding these treatments, and what clients can expect relating to costs, eligibility, and medical outcomes.

The Role of GLP-1 Medications
GLP-1 is a hormonal agent naturally produced in the intestines. It plays an essential function in controling blood sugar level levels and cravings. GLP-1 receptor agonists simulate this hormone, causing a number of physiological results:
- Increased Satiety: Patients feel full sooner and for longer durations.
- Postponed Gastric Emptying: Food remains in the stomach longer, slowing the absorption of glucose.
- Improved Insulin Secretion: The pancreas launches insulin more efficiently in response to blood sugar level increases.

Eligibility Criteria for GLP-1 Treatment In Germany, the guidelines forrecommending GLP-1 medications for weight-loss are strictly specified by medical associations and regulatory bodies. Normally, a client must fulfill one of the following requirements: BMI over 30 kg/m ²: Categorized as medical weight problems. BMI over 27 kg/m ² with Comorbidities: This includes weight-related problems such as Type
2 diabetes, dyslipidemia( high cholesterol), hypertension, or obstructive sleep apnea. Failed Conservative Therapy: Evidence that the patient has actually previously tried to lose weight through diet plan and exercise without sustainable success. Benefits

and Costs GLP-1-Dosierung In Deutschland Germany The monetary element of GLP-1 treatment is a significant consideration for clients in Germany.
The German healthcare
system compares"Statutory Health Insurance"( Gesetzliche Krankenkasse -GKV )and" Private Health Insurance "(Private Krankenversicherung-PKV). Statutory Insurance(GKV): Currently, German law( SGB V)classifies weight reduction medications as "way of life drugs."This suggests that GKV companies normally do not cover the expense of medications like Wegovy or Saxenda for weight-loss. Nevertheless, if the medication is recommended forType 2 Diabetes(e.g.,
Ozempic), it is fully covered minus a small co-pay. Personal Insurance (PKV ):
Coverage varies considerably by service provider and specific agreement. Lots of private insurance providers will cover the treatmentif a medical need is clearly recorded by the clinic. Self-Payers(Selbstzahler): Many clients in Germany spend for weight-loss prescriptions expense. Prices for a regular monthly supply can vary from EUR170 to over EUR300 depending upon the medication and dosage. Physical Activity Programs: Custom workout prepares designed for patients with joint pain or low cardiovascular fitness.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Is Ozempic available for weight-loss in Germany? Technically, Ozempic is only authorized for Type 2 Diabetes in Germany. While"off-label"prescribing is lawfully possible, the BfArM has actually suggested against it due to worldwide lacks, urging medical professionals to reserve Ozempic for diabetic patients. For weight reduction, Wegovy is the approved equivalent. For how long does the treatment last? GLP-1 treatment is typically considered as a long-lasting treatment for a chronic condition. Clinical data recommends that numerous patients gain back
weight if the medication is stopped without long-term lifestyle modifications. Lots of centers prepare for a multi-year treatment trajectory. Can I get GLP-1 medications online in Germany?
There are"telemedicine"clinics operating in Germany that can release digital prescriptions (e-recipes). Nevertheless, clients should guarantee the provider is licensed in Germany and requires a video consultation and genuine blood work. Beware of counterfeit products sold on uncontrolled websites.Do I need a referral to check out a GLP-1 clinic? For personal clinics, a recommendation is typically not essential. For specialized "Adipositas"departmentsin university hospitals or public clinics,
a recommendation from a General Practitioner(GP
)is typically required. Exist contraindications for GLP-1 treatment? Yes. Patients with an individual or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ma or Multiple Endocrine Neoplasia syndrome type 2 (MEN 2)need to not utilize these medications.
